>>I'm looking for a program that can count the number of times "!" happens in an
>>opening book that I'm putting together. ! is used at the end of each opening so
>>that would give me a count of the openings.
>>
>>Something that works in Dos or Linux that I can compile to run in Dos.
>>
>>I can't find a way to do it with grep. And there's another Linux utility called
>>"WC" that appears to count the total amount of words, but I havn't figured a way
>>to get it to count that one specific "!" string.
>>
>>Thanks
>>
>>Pete
>
>Pete,
>
>If the "!" appears at the end of the line try:
>grep -c !$ <filename>
>
>Steve
